Lavangelene 'Vangie' Aereka Williams [1] is an American author[2] and politician[3] who is the Democratic candidate for the US House of Representatives in Virginia's 1st congressional district, and wrote Broken Life Journals.

Personal Life[edit]

Vangie Williams is an African-American who traces her ancestry in Virginia over three hundred years. In 2010 she filed for bankruptcy due to medical costs of her sick daughter. [4] She works as a strategic analyst for a federal contractor.
